Italian Design Heritage Showcased in New Furnishings and Products
A curated selection of ten products from Italian brands highlights the nation's enduring legacy of craftsmanship and design innovation, featuring everything from statement seating to artistic tile work.


A recent showcase on Dezeen highlights ten distinct products and furnishings from Italian brands that continue to champion the country’s rich design and craft heritage. This collection, featured on Dezeen Showroom, offers a glimpse into contemporary Italian style, blending traditional techniques with modern sensibilities.
The featured items span a range of categories, from statement seating and sophisticated lighting to unique interior materials. Each piece underscores Italy’s long-standing reputation for producing design-led, high-quality goods that resonate globally.
Featured Products and Brands
The selection includes a variety of pieces, each with a unique narrative rooted in Italian design principles. Among the notable items is a headboard adorned with oversized ceramic beads, a testament to artisanal skill and playful design. Other highlights include speakers elegantly mounted on marble plinths, marrying functionality with sculptural form, and chairs whose design is directly informed by the fluid process of hand-sketching.
